Singaporean Survives Fiery BMW Crash in Kuala Lumpur, 2 Other Burnt To Death

A 20-year-old Singaporean man has emerged as the sole survivor of a devastating road accident in Kuala Lumpur after the BMW he was travelling in burst into flames in the early hours of June 27.

The fatal crash occurred along the Jalan Kuching exit ramp of the Duta-Ulu Kelang Expressway (DUKE), where the luxury vehicle reportedly lost control before colliding with a road divider and catching fire.

According to Malaysian authorities, the Singaporean was seated in the rear of the vehicle and managed to escape with relatively minor injuries. The two other occupants, however, were unable to get out of the burning car in time and tragically lost their lives at the scene.

Vehicle Engulfed in Flames

Emergency services were alerted to the incident at approximately 5:20am. Firefighters arriving at the location found the BMW already engulfed in flames.

Rescue personnel immediately began efforts to save those trapped inside. While one occupant was successfully removed from the vehicle, the remaining two victims were unable to escape as the fire rapidly intensified.

Fire crews eventually extinguished the blaze, but the car was completely destroyed by the intense heat. Authorities described the vehicle as having been severely damaged beyond recognition.

Victims Were University Students

Initial investigations revealed that the BMW was being driven by a 22-year-old Malaysian student who was pursuing studies at the University of Brisbane in Australia.

The front-seat passenger was identified as a 21-year-old student enrolled at Sunway University in Malaysia. Both young men were pronounced dead following the accident.

Due to the extent of the fire damage, officials are carrying out DNA testing to formally confirm the identities of the deceased. Authorities said the identification process is ongoing.

Survivor Suffers Minor Injuries

The Singaporean survivor sustained injuries to his hands and legs but was reported to be in stable condition. He was transported to Kuala Lumpur Hospital for medical treatment shortly after the crash.

Investigators have already recorded his statement as part of efforts to determine exactly what happened in the moments leading up to the collision.

Police are also reviewing available evidence from the area, including CCTV footage, to establish a clearer picture of the circumstances surrounding the crash.

Speed Among Possible Factors

Preliminary findings suggest the vehicle may have been travelling at a high speed before the driver lost control.

Authorities believe the impact with the road divider triggered the fire that quickly spread through the vehicle. However, investigators have not yet reached a final conclusion regarding the exact cause of either the collision or the subsequent blaze.

The case remains under active investigation as police work to piece together the events that led to the tragic accident. The incident has also sparked renewed discussion about road safety and the dangers associated with high-speed driving, particularly during the early morning hours when visibility and reaction times can be affected.
